From 1 July 2017, all applications and approvals for tariff concessions can be found on the New Zealand Customs Service website.

Amendments and withdrawals are published in the Gazette. These notices can be found under the Tariff Act.

Declined applications listed in the Fourth Schedule to this notice will not be published in the Consolidated List of Approvals.

A request for a decision to be reconsidered must be lodged with Customs within 20 working days of the notification of the decision in the Customs Edition of the New Zealand Gazette.
